CatalogCache environments — Brindlemart. Three tiers: dev, stage, prod. Invalidation fans out from the PriceSync topic; prod has a 90-second propagation SLO. Stage shares the dev Redis cluster — expect noisy evictions there. If stale prices appear in prod, check the invalidator consumer lag first, then the TTL overrides. Never flush the whole cache in prod; use keyspace-scoped purges. The prod invalidator boots with the following configuration.

deployment values, bahif-bagep:
FENIEL_PIN=6351
FENIEL_TENANT=ulays
FENIEL_METRICS_HOST=metrics.feniel.novacdata.test
FENIEL_SEAL=seal_8d076180
FENIEL_STANDBY_TEAM=ulair

Action item: The Relayn deploy-status bot silently dropped updates when the pipeline API paginated results, so responders believed a rollback had completed when it had not. We will add pagination handling, a staleness banner, and an integration test. Until merged, verify deploy state directly in the pipeline console, documented at the page below.

runbook for kahop-kajop: https://rundeck.ordinio.test/display/secrets/pipeline/issue/pages/repo/browse/e5732776e07d1285107e5aeb

MEMO — Veltrane Systems, Receiving, Dorsey Point site

Six Quillax M4 demo units are being returned from the Harwick trade floor. All were powered down and factory-reset by the field team; do not re-image before intake inspection. Log serial plates against the loan sheet and flag any missing styli. Cartons are marked DEMO RETURN in orange. Expected arrival Thursday morning via courier. Storage bay 3 is reserved. The confidential hand-over instruction for the courier follows below.

courier memo of kagug-yajof: the belys wenok courier leaves the praix ledger at gate 8902 under passcode 669584

### Action Item: Spoolhaven Retry Storm

From last Tuesday's outage: the Spoolhaven print service retried failed jobs without backoff, saturating the render pool. Fix merged; retries now use capped exponential backoff with jitter. Owner will monitor for a week before closing. The agreed retry constants are recorded below.

constants for yadup-kajof:
RATE_LIMITS = {
    "zorwyn": 1,
    "druwyn": 1,
}